Module 5: Pinduli


Pinduli
Written and illustrated by Janell Cannon
ISBN: 9780152046682
Publisher: Harcourt, 2004
Price: $16.00

Winsome illustrations of Pinduli help soften the image of an animal not well loved by most. Pinduli uses her wits to outsmart her bullies into leaving food for her. Children of all ages will identify with the struggles Pinduli goes through. Janell Cannon has woven in bits of facts with her folktale-like story of an unusual animal we come to love.



Reviews:
Teaching Pre-K -8: Katherine Pierpoint writes, "Now, as a hugely successful author and illustrator, Janell Cannon just can't keep herself from bringing unloved and sometimes misunderstood animal friends to our doorsteps. With her latest offering for children, Pinduli (Harcourt, 2004), Janell has shed light on yet another oft-maligned creature - the hyena.

Pierpoint, Katherine. "Janell Cannon: Mysteries of the Misunderstood." Teaching Pre K - 8 35, no. 7 (2005): 42-44. http://ezproxy.twu.edu:2052/login.aspx?direct=true&db=a9h&AN=16489100&site=ehost-live.



Library Media Connection, Nancy Keating writes, " This picture book is great to use for science lessons about animals with younger children. The information contained in the book, however, would make it of interest to older children."

Keating, Nancy. "Pinduli." Library Media Connection 23, no. 7 (2005): 72. http://ezproxy.twu.edu:2052/login.aspx?direct=true&db=a9h&AN=16602966&site=ehost-live.
